Yes this happens to me. I have a 4 week old Jeep Grand Cherokee, a 3 week old Moto X and a 2 day old Moto 360. Phone and 360 are running latest updates.

I have Spotify and Google music installed. Noticed it on first time using it with the 360 and the music app with the file stored on the phone. Started as pauses, then strange skipping and different speed play, got worse then finally unresponsive. Spotify was playing ok but the next day I had the same problem in Spotify.
Disconnect the watch, problem resolved.
